Transaction 76b592c5fc4f549f91ef5b6a56e99224faa5fcec2e4a1e177695c2dc53fa324b
1 Input
1 Output
-
76b592c5fc4f549f91ef5b6a56e99224faa5fcec2e4a1e177695c2dc53fa324b:0
- value
- 20283
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0a05242b0cd8cb24177ce21939d5cb38484b63ff96c9ae1363ded0f919b05544
- address
- bc1ppgzjg2cvmr9jg9muugvnn4wt8pyykclljmy6uymrmmg0jxds24zqw3uznm